Handover note — Crumbwheel order cutoffs.

Welcome aboard. The bakery cutoff rule in Crumbwheel closes same-day orders at 14:00 local to each storefront, not UTC — this has bitten us twice. Holiday overrides live in the calendar service and take precedence silently, so always check there first when a cutoff looks wrong. To unlock the calendar service's admin console after a restart, enter the recovery passphrase below.

vault phrase of bagap-bahaf = silion-pelox-sorox-casdor-quenwyn-fraax-eliox-praael-kelion-quenvan-kasox-rusael-norius-belvan

## Retrying failed exports

If a nightly export from Quillbatch fails, do not rerun the full pipeline. Trigger the retry job instead; it picks up only the failed partitions and is idempotent. Retries past three attempts require sign-off from the release manager. The retry job honors the backoff and concurrency settings from the deployment configuration, shown below.

config for tagep-yajef:
ulawyn:
  log_level: error
  metrics_host: metrics.ulawyn.lumiclabs.internal
  pin: 0564
  pool_size: 32

Subject: Legacy pricing — decision needed

Team,

Welcoming Director Halvoren with a clean summary. Legacy customers on the old Brightmere contracts remain 18% below current rates. Proposal: phase increases over two cycles starting Q3, cap at 9% per cycle, grandfather nothing past next year. Churn modeling by the Varlo desk shows acceptable attrition. I want sign-off by Friday. Push harder on the Kestwick accounts if needed. The confidential planning note follows below for context.

management briefing: Only 34 of the 227 pilot accounts renewed Julath, so a churn review is set for December 28. Jorwynox Foods is in early talks to buy Silirix Freight for about $241.8 million.

Subject: Report export timezones — Gridmont feed

Team,

Exports now emit all timestamps in UTC with an explicit offset column; the old behavior silently used the generating node's local zone, which broke daylight-saving comparisons. Maintainers: do not reintroduce zone-local formatting anywhere in the export path. Affected endpoints are /exports/daily and /exports/summary. Regression tests run against the partner sandbox nightly. Calls to the sandbox export API must carry the token below.

portal login ticket: eyJhbGciOiJIUzI1NiIsInR5cCI6IkpXVCJ9.eyJzdWIiOiIwEOsktwVNwIn0.-UJU3fdyyCgG